Your main ingredients are smoked sausage, diced tomatoes, and pasta. The tri-color rotini is our favorite for this dish because it grabs onto the tomatoes and adds some great color. Feel free to add in some chopped onions or bell pepper if you want, but I primarily serve it with just these three ingredients.
While fresh tomatoes are delicious, canned tomatoes work lovely for this recipe too. The tomatoes perfectly complement the smoked sausage flavors. - Smoked Sausage
- Diced Tomatoes (1 fresh or a 14 ounce can)
- 1 box pasta (16 ounces)
- Fill a pot with water and bring to a boil for your pasta.
- While the water is boiling slice the sausage into bite-sized pieces.
- Heat the sausage and tomatoes in a non-stick skillet over medium heat, stirring occasionally.
- Cook the pasta according to the directions on the box.
- Combine the pasta with the sausage and tomatoes.
- Serve!
